I am going to do a mail-out of books, single as well as batches of 5 or ten at the time. I am looking for strong wrapping materials, corrugated cardboard, single or multiple layere, bubble wrap, small boxes etc.

Unfortunately, the bubble wrap envelopes sold by Thailand post are not strong enough, made of flimsy paper.

Can anyone point me to a supplier of such packaging, preferably Pattaya region, but BKK would be OK, too.

there is a shop on Suhumvit Road that sells all sorts of bubble wrap, styrofoam etc...

Coming from North, it is on the left hand side, between North Pattaya Road and Klang.

I have been to a arts and craft type shop on Pattaya Klang, to buy some shipping tubes, and was really surprised at the variety of items they had. I have been searching for these tubes everywhere, office depot, and many other places. A couple other items that I had searched for, I found there too. Unfortunately I dont remember the name of the shop, but its on the left hand side as you are going toward Sukhumvit, maybe a few hundred meters from Sukhumvit. Its kind of like a Thai shop, but not messy, and just full of artist and shipping supplies.

^ Silpabarn, just near Foodland.

Yes, thats the name, Silpabarn

^ Silpabarn, just near Foodland.

best stationary shop in town. Far better than Office Depot.
